### Checklist item 7: Verify StatusQuill announcements

Before marking the release complete, confirm that StatusQuill (the deploy-status chat bot) posts start, progress, and completion messages to the #releases room for the new version. Trigger a dry-run deploy against the Hollowmere staging cluster and watch for all three messages within two minutes each. If any message is missing, roll back the bot config before the production cut — silent deploys have burned us before. Record the build token that appears below in the release log.

trace token, fafog-kageg: htk4_98e6

Ticket: Expired credentials causing cold-start failures in Fennelrun handlers. Plugin authors reported that serverless handlers fetch credentials during init, and since the old Vaultbridge keys expired last week, every cold start now fails before the handler body runs. Warm instances keep working until recycled, which made this hard to spot. We have rotated the internal service key; please update your plugin's init config with the new value, which is provided below.

service key, bajep-hahig: zpat15_8GdlyV2kd9BCqYH

# Build Provenance — PickPath Optimizer

All plugin authors integrating with the PickPath warehouse pick-list optimizer must verify the provenance of the core binary before shipping. Each release is built on the Ferrowell CI cluster, signed, and published with an attestation manifest describing the source revision, builder image, and dependency lockfile. Plugins compiled against unverified binaries will be rejected at load time. To confirm you are targeting the current release, compare against the token published below.

pipeline stamp: htk31_f769b577b3028a4e9958e5bb8d1259a